Dr. Abdul M. Orra, DO

13535 Detroit Ave Ste 4, Lakewood, OH 44107

Dr. Kelly A. Boghosian, DO

14600 Detroit Ave Ste 103, Lakewood, OH 44107

Dr. Abdul M. Orra, DO

13535 Detroit Ave Ste 4, Lakewood, OH 44107

Dr. Kelly A. Boghosian, DO

14600 Detroit Ave Ste 103, Lakewood, OH 44107

Doctor Directory | TOS | twitter | FB | Angel | blog